Finance - Private Banking and International Wealth Management
International University of Monaco (IUM)Program Overview
The Finance - Private Banking and International Wealth Management at International University of Monaco (IUM) is a MSc programme in Business & Management over 16 months, delivered On-campus. Key Program Features
- Duration: 16 months
- Language of instruction: English
- Study mode: On-campus
- Tuition: EUR 20,550 (Tuition (Full programme)) — International students; EUR 20,550 (Tuition (Full programme)) — EU/EEA students
- Location: Monte Carlo, Monaco

Program Curriculum
Course Structure
- Stock and Bond Valuation
- Risk Management
- Derivative Products and Strategies
- Corporate Finance
- Investment Banking
- Financial Acconting for Investments
- Macroeconomics for Financial Forecasting
- Statistics and Financial Data Analysis
- Portofolio Theory and Management
- Research Methods Workshop
Admission Requirements
Academic Requirements
- A 3 or 4-year university degree
- Proof of English proficiency
